NVIDIA Open-Sources OmniVinci Multimodal AI Model
NVIDIA Breaks New Ground with Efficient Multimodal AI
NVIDIA Research has open-sourced its advanced OmniVinci multimodal understanding model, marking a significant leap in artificial intelligence capabilities. The model demonstrates remarkable efficiency, requiring only 0.2 trillion training tokens compared to competitors' 1.2 trillion while outperforming them by 19.05 points in benchmark tests.

Architectural Breakthroughs
The model employs several groundbreaking technologies:
- OmniAlignNet: Specialized module aligning visual and audio data streams
- Temporal embedding grouping: Enhances sequential data processing
- Constrained rotational temporal embedding: Improves time-series comprehension
These components work synergistically within a unified latent space framework, allowing seamless information exchange between modalities before feeding into NVIDIA's large language model backbone.
Two-Stage Training Approach
The research team implemented an innovative training regimen:
- Modality-specific pre-training: Individual optimization of visual, audio, and text processing pathways
- Full-modal joint training: Integrated learning that reinforces cross-modal associations
This methodology yielded surprising efficiency gains while maintaining exceptional accuracy across all tested benchmarks.
